Subject: [PATCH] linux-2.4.22-pre2_x440-acpi-fix_A0
Date: 27 Jun 2003 17:34:45 -0700 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1056760485.28320.242.camel@w-jstultz2.beaverton.ibm.com> (raw)
Andy, all,
This patch fixes the new ACPI booting code to work XAPIC systems like
the IBM x440s. Please add to your tree and send to Marcelo.
thanks
-john
diff -Nru a/arch/i386/kernel/acpi.c b/arch/i386/kernel/acpi.c
--- a/arch/i386/kernel/acpi.c Fri Jun 27 17:28:24 2003
+++ b/arch/i386/kernel/acpi.c Fri Jun 27 17:28:24 2003
@@ -129,6 +129,8 @@
printk(KERN_INFO PREFIX "Local APIC address 0x%08x\n",
madt->lapic_address);
+ acpi_madt_oem_check(madt->header.oem_id, madt->header.oem_table_id);
+
return 0;
}
diff -Nru a/arch/i386/kernel/io_apic.c b/arch/i386/kernel/io_apic.c
--- a/arch/i386/kernel/io_apic.c Fri Jun 27 17:28:24 2003
+++ b/arch/i386/kernel/io_apic.c Fri Jun 27 17:28:24 2003
@@ -1732,6 +1732,13 @@
apic_id = reg_00.ID;
}
+ /* XAPICs do not need unique IDs */
+ if (clustered_apic_mode == CLUSTERED_APIC_XAPIC){
+ printk(KERN_INFO "IOAPIC[%d]: Assigned apic_id %d\n",
+ ioapic, apic_id);
+ return apic_id;
+ }
+
/*
* Every APIC in a system must have a unique ID or we get lots of nice
* 'stuck on smp_invalidate_needed IPI wait' messages.
diff -Nru a/arch/i386/kernel/mpparse.c b/arch/i386/kernel/mpparse.c
--- a/arch/i386/kernel/mpparse.c Fri Jun 27 17:28:24 2003
+++ b/arch/i386/kernel/mpparse.c Fri Jun 27 17:28:24 2003
@@ -1252,6 +1252,23 @@
io_apic_set_pci_routing(ioapic, ioapic_pin, irq);
}
+/* Hook from generic ACPI tables.c */
+void __init acpi_madt_oem_check(char *oem_id, char *oem_table_id)
+{
+ if (!strncmp(oem_id, "IBM", 3) &&
+ (!strncmp(oem_table_id, "SERVIGIL", 8) ||
+ !strncmp(oem_table_id, "EXA", 3) ||
+ !strncmp(oem_table_id, "RUTHLESS", 8))){
+ clustered_apic_mode = CLUSTERED_APIC_XAPIC;
+ apic_broadcast_id = APIC_BROADCAST_ID_XAPIC;
+ int_dest_addr_mode = APIC_DEST_PHYSICAL;
+ int_delivery_mode = dest_Fixed;
+ esr_disable = 1;
+ /*Start cyclone clock*/
+ cyclone_setup(0);
+ }
+}
+
#ifdef CONFIG_ACPI_PCI
void __init mp_parse_prt (void)
diff -Nru a/include/asm-i386/acpi.h b/include/asm-i386/acpi.h
--- a/include/asm-i386/acpi.h Fri Jun 27 17:28:24 2003
+++ b/include/asm-i386/acpi.h Fri Jun 27 17:28:24 2003
@@ -165,6 +165,9 @@
/* early initialization routine */
extern void acpi_reserve_bootmem(void);
+/* Check for special HW using OEM name lists */
+extern void acpi_madt_oem_check(char *oem_id, char *oem_table_id);
+
#endif /*CONFIG_ACPI_SLEEP*/
